Things to do in Deadwood?
Living in Deadwood, SD is a unique experience. The city has a rich history of being the home of Wild West legends such as Wild Bill Hickok and Calamity Jane, making it an exciting place to explore and learn about its past. Despite having a small population of just 1,200 people, the city includes a variety of attractions, including casinos, saloons, museums, and theaters. Things to do in Berkeley?
Berkeley, California is a vibrant city in the San Francisco Bay Area. It's home to many educational and cultural attractions, such as the University of California at Berkeley, the Lawrence Hall of Science, and live music venues like The Greek Theater. Recreational activities are plentiful as well; visitors can take in views of the Bay from Tilden Regional Park or enjoy a day of sun at Berkeley Marina. Shopping options range from local boutiques to some of the finest retail stores in Northern California while dining experiences could take you anywhere from gourmet restaurants to street food vendors.
